I really dislike the meme of "We could be exploring the stars if we still had the Library!"

Sure, many works were lost entirely, but supposedly most of the works that were of actual interest to the Greeks were basically exegeses on Homer and his poetry, or just expansions on the Trojan cycle. Most of the stuff that was also lost was either just philosophy, poetry or history, and whatever scientific, mathematical or technical work may have been in there was either already in use or was irrelevant. Basically, I don't think we lost any classical Theory of Relativities of Origin of Species.
